-
python – 在Jupyter问题中的Plotly
所属栏目:[Python] 日期:2020-12-16 热度:59
我安装了plotly.py来使用Jupyter来处理一些图,但我无法导入它. ! pip install plotly --upgradeRequirement already up-to-date: plotly in c:python34libsite-packagesRequirement already up-to-date: requests in c:python34libsite-packages (from[详细]
-
python – Zope:无法在属性装饰器下访问REQUEST
所属栏目:[Python] 日期:2020-12-16 热度:177
我正在尝试在类中使用属??性装饰器.虽然它本身很好用,但我不能使用任何必须访问REQUEST的代码. class SomeClass(): #Zope magic code _properties=({'id':'someValue','type':'ustring','mode':'r'},) def get_someValue(self): return self.REQUEST @proper[详细]
-
使用远程存储配置django-compressor(django-storage – amazon s
所属栏目:[Python] 日期:2020-12-16 热度:107
我的情景 我正在使用django-storage来通过Amazon S3提供文件. 这意味着当我执行./manage.py collectstatic时,文件将保存在亚马逊的存储桶中,而不是本地文件系统上. 要压缩我做的文件:“./ manage.py compress” 这给出了这个错误: 错误:渲染期间发生错误[详细]
-
Python元循环评估器
所属栏目:[Python] 日期:2020-12-16 热度:183
一个介绍编程类编写一个Lisp metacircular评估器并不罕见.有没有试图为 Python做这个? 是的,我知道Lisp的结构和语法很适合于一个元模型评估器等等.Python很可能会更难.我只是好奇是否已经做出这样的尝试. 解决方法 对于那些不知道元循环评估者是什么的人来[详细]
-
python – Numpy多维数组索引交换轴顺序
所属栏目:[Python] 日期:2020-12-16 热度:98
我正在使用多维Numpy数组.我注意到在使用其他索引数组访问这些数组时会出现一些不一致的行为.例如: import numpy as npstart = np.zeros((7,5,3))a = start[:,:,np.arange(2)]b = start[0,np.arange(2)]c = start[0,:2]print 'a:',a.shapeprint 'b:',b.shap[详细]
-
python – subprocess.call不等待进程完成
所属栏目:[Python] 日期:2020-12-16 热度:100
根据 Python文档,subprocess.call应该阻塞并等待子进程完成.在这段代码中,我试图通过在命令行上调用Libreoffice将少量xls文件转换为新格式.我假设对子进程调用的调用是阻塞的,但似乎我需要在每次调用后添加一个人工延迟,否则我会错过out目录中的几个文件. 我[详细]
-
django自定义用户模型密码未被哈希处理
所属栏目:[Python] 日期:2020-12-16 热度:70
我有自己的自定义用户模型,也有自己的Manger. 楷模: class MyUser(AbstractBaseUser,PermissionsMixin): email = models.EmailField(max_length=255,unique=True) first_name = models.CharField(max_length=35) last_name = models.CharField(max_length=3[详细]
-
python – 转储解析文档时是否可以保留YAML块结构?
所属栏目:[Python] 日期:2020-12-16 热度:84
我们使用PyYAML为不同的环境准备配置文件.但是我们的YAML阻止了完整性. 给input.yml … pubkey: | -----BEGIN PUBLIC KEY----- MIGfMA0GCSq7OPxRrQEBAQUAA4GNADCBiQKBgQCvRVUKp6pr4qBEnE9lviuyfiNq QtG/OCyBDXL4Bh3FmUzfNI+Z4Bh3FmUx+z2n0FCv/4BpgHTDl8D95NP[详细]
-
在Python中对多个列上的numpy数组进行排序
所属栏目:[Python] 日期:2020-12-16 热度:115
我试图在column1上排序以下数组,然后是column2然后是column3 [['2008' '1' '23' 'AAPL' 'Buy' '100'] ['2008' '1' '30' 'AAPL' 'Sell' '100'] ['2008' '1' '23' 'GOOG' 'Buy' '100'] ['2008' '1' '30' 'GOOG' 'Sell' '100'] ['2008' '9' '8' 'GOOG' 'Buy' '1[详细]
-
在终端上打印python os.urandom输出
所属栏目:[Python] 日期:2020-12-16 热度:141
如何在终端中打印os.urandom(n)的输出? 我尝试使用fabfile生成SECRET_KEY,并输出24个字节. 我如何在python shell中实现两个变体的示例: import os out = os.urandom(24) out'oSxf8xf4xe2xc8xdaxe3x7fxc75*x83xb1x06x8cx85xa4xa7piExd6I' p[详细]
-
python – Numpy.dot()维度未对齐
所属栏目:[Python] 日期:2020-12-16 热度:174
我无法向scipy.signal.dlsim方法提供正确的输入. 该方法需要4个状态空间矩阵: A = np.array([ [0.9056,-0.1908,0.0348,0.0880],[0.0973,0.8728,0.4091,-0.0027],[0.0068,-0.1694,0.9729,-0.6131],[-0.0264,0.0014,0.1094,0.6551] ])B = np.array([ [0,-0.00[详细]
-
python – 在不同时间在同一行上打印到屏幕
所属栏目:[Python] 日期:2020-12-16 热度:89
我的代码看起来像这样: print "Doing Something...",do_some_function_that_takes_a_long_time()print "Done" 我希望它首先在屏幕顶部打印该语句,然后执行该功能,然后打[详细]
-
如何绑定tkinter中的退格键以删除多个字符?
所属栏目:[Python] 日期:2020-12-16 热度:108
我想创建绑定,让我按Tab键插入预定义数量的空格,然后按退格键删除那么多空格,基于变量. 当用户按下退格键时,如何删除预定数量的空格?我不知道如何删除多个字符,当我试图解决这个问题时,绑定会删除错误的字符数. 解决方法 这个问题分为两部分.第一部分与如何[详细]
-
200新新新新旗新新新新新旗新新旗新新旗新旗新新旗新旗新旗新
所属栏目:[Python] 日期:2020-12-16 热度:50
我想修改/改变 floatformat的工作方式. 默认情况下,它会改变输入十进制: {{ 1.00|floatformat }} - 1{{ 1.50|floatformat }} - 1.5{{ 1.53|floatformat }} - 1.53 我想改变这个abit:如果有一个浮动部分,它应该保持前2个浮动数字.如果没有浮动(这意味着.00)[详细]
-
python – 命名元组的名称和引用可以不同吗?
所属栏目:[Python] 日期:2020-12-16 热度:157
在阅读fmark对问题 What are “named tuples” in Python?的回答时,我看到那里给出的示例具有相同的名称和引用,即Point在以下语句中出现两次: Point = namedtuple(‘Point’,’x y’) 所以我去了原始参考: https://docs.python.org/2/library/collections.[详细]
-
python – 在pandas数据框中散列每个值
所属栏目:[Python] 日期:2020-12-16 热度:186
在 python中,我试图找到最快的方法来散列pandas数据框中的每个值. 我知道任何字符串都可以使用: hash('a string') 但是如何在pandas数据框的每个元素上应用此函数? 这可能是一件非常简单的事情,但我刚刚开始使用python. 解决方法 传递散列函数以应用于str[详细]
-
Python中的时区转换
所属栏目:[Python] 日期:2020-12-16 热度:111
我可能错过了一些关于时区的事情: import datetime,pytz date = datetime.datetime(2013,9,3,16,tzinfo=pytz.timezone("Europe/Paris")) date.astimezone(pytz.UTC)datetime.datetime(2013,15,51,tzinfo=UTC) 我在期待 datetime.datetime(2013,00,tzinfo=UT[详细]
-
在python日志记录中使用dictConfig,需要创建一个不同于在dict中
所属栏目:[Python] 日期:2020-12-16 热度:104
我有一个LOG_SETTINGS dict,如下所示: LOG_SETTINGS = {'version': 1,'handlers': { 'console': { 'class': 'logging.StreamHandler','level': 'INFO','formatter': 'detailed','stream': 'ext://sys.stdout',},'file': { 'class': 'logging.handlers.Rotat[详细]
-
python – cqlsh连接错误:’ref()不采用关键字参数’
所属栏目:[Python] 日期:2020-12-16 热度:60
我已经尝试了从 this post和 Cassandra doc的所有措施. 我尝试运行所有版本的Cassandra,包括从tarball和Debian软件包的最新版本3.7,但是当我执行cqlsh时,我不断收到错误. 错误: Connection error: (‘Unable to connect to any servers’,{‘127.0.0.1’: T[详细]
-
更多的pythonic方法迭代列表,同时排除元素每次迭代
所属栏目:[Python] 日期:2020-12-16 热度:78
我有以下代码: items = ["one","two","three"]for i in range(0,len(items)): for index,element in enumerate(items): if index != i: # do something with element 基本上我想排除每一个元素一次,并重复其余的.所以对于我上面的列表,我想要以下迭代: “[详细]
-
python – 隐形水印在图像
所属栏目:[Python] 日期:2020-12-16 热度:167
如何在图像中插入隐形水印以实现版权?我正在寻找一个 python库. 你使用什么算法?性能和效率怎么样? 解决方法 你可能想看看隐写术;这是在图像内隐藏数据.如果您将图像转换为损失格式,甚至裁剪图像的部分,则表单不会丢失.[详细]
-
Python – 具有有限十进制数字的随机浮点数
所属栏目:[Python] 日期:2020-12-16 热度:170
我刚刚发现了如何在 Python中创建随机数,但是如果我将它们打印出来,它们都有15个十进制数字.我该如何解决这个问题? 这是我的代码: import randomimport osgreaterThan = float(input("Your number will be greater than: "))lessThan = float(input("Your[详细]
-
python – AttributeError:’str’对象没有属性’regex’django
所属栏目:[Python] 日期:2020-12-16 热度:152
我正在使用 django 1.9,我目前正在编码 – 在 Windows命令提示符 – python manage.py makemigrations和错误: AttributeError:’str’对象没有属性’regex’ 我试过编码: url(r'^$','firstsite.module.views.start',name="home"),url(r'^admin/',include([详细]
-
如何在Python 3.1中将字符串转换为缓冲区?
所属栏目:[Python] 日期:2020-12-16 热度:181
我试图使用以下行来管道子进程: p.communicate("insert into egg values ('egg');");TypeError: must be bytes or buffer,not str 如何将字符串转换为缓冲区? 解决方法 正确的答案是: p.communicate(b"insert into egg values ('egg');"); 注意前导b,告诉[详细]
-
python – 如何在使用PIL裁剪图像时设置坐标?
所属栏目:[Python] 日期:2020-12-16 热度:184
我不知道如何在PILs crop()中设置裁剪图像的坐标: from PIL import Imageimg = Image.open("Supernatural.xlsxscreenshot.png")img2 = img.crop((0,201,335))img2.save("img2.jpg") 我尝试使用gThumb来获取坐标,但如果我选择了一个我想裁剪的区域,我只能找[详细]
